I am at 0 food and I have no more berries, I found the rich soil, but I keep taking my sims there and they are not doing anything. Where is another source of food? I keep reading there are 3 sources. I have taken my vs all over the island and cannot find any other food source.

You need farming level 2 to use the soil. This is what your tech points are for.

Think of it like an RPG in a way. The tech points are like your experience, so that you can level up your skills.

Most of us have had all of our villagers die the first time or two that we played the game. That's how we learn what works and what doesn't!

One successful strategy for getting your village going is to put two villagers to work foraging for food and the rest of the villagers working at the research table. That way, you'll be able to purchase Harvesting L2 before your village runs out of food. You should also hold off on growing your population until you get farming, because the kids eat as much as the adults. If you start the game on easy, you'll get 6 villagers (and that will give you an extra person to do research)!

VSSTEF, well if they are all dead, then yes you will need to start over. At the very beginning, most players will concentrate on getting level two harvest. As you can see that is very important, as the berry bush will not produce enough berries to keep the villagers feed. And as you can see on the info screen on Harvesting, level three will get you the third source of food.

I don't mess around with docs. I'll put three on food detail as soon as i start and the other two on research. Once food gets oaver 500, i'll put four on research and one on harvesting. When food gets close to 400, i'll move one of the researchers over to food detail again, and so fourth. Once I get haversting 2, i'll pretty much keep two on food and the rest on research and start breeding.

There are lots of different ways to play this game, and this is just the way I do it.
